## Environments: Tax-Rate Lookup Cache

The Quillbrook pricing service keeps a per-region cache of tax-rate lookups to avoid hammering the upstream rates provider. Entries are keyed by jurisdiction code and expire on a fixed TTL rather than on provider change events, so stale reads are possible within the window; reviewers should weigh any TTL change against billing accuracy. Staging uses a deliberately short TTL to surface invalidation bugs early. Each environment runs with the cache parameters listed below.

service settings:
[casax]
port = 6379
team = rusir
host = casax.zemvarhq.corp
region = outer-4
access_code = ac_9808ce
timeout_ms = 1500

**Q: Where's the mail room gone?**

Heads up, team assistants — the mail room at Quillbrook Place has moved from the basement to level 1, just past the Copper Lounge. Same pigeonholes, same sorting times (10am and 3pm). Couriers now buzz through the side lobby, so no more basement runs! The new door is badge-plus-keypad; tap your pass and enter the code below.

door code, kawip-bagap: bdg-HQEWH-4

Hi Verla — handing over the Bramwick Expo pop-up office before I head back. Keys for the cabinet are in the grey tin, projector remote is taped under the desk. Cleaners come at 18:00, let them in. The side door to the hall locks automatically, so keep this pass on you at all times.

door code, yagap-bahof: bdg-O-05

Migration step 4: StageGlint seat-map renderer, v2 cutover for the Marbury Playhouse tenant. Stop the v1 render workers first. Drain the tile queue; confirm zero in-flight jobs. Swap the renderer binary, then point the balcony and stalls layouts at the new geometry service. Do not restart until the cache is flushed — v1 tiles poison v2 output. Rollback is binary swap plus queue replay, nothing else. Apply the new renderer settings exactly as listed below.

config for kafof-bawef:
holath:
  log_level: debug
  metrics_host: metrics.holath.qorvelsys.internal
  pin: 2191
  pool_size: 32